Kingdom of Night is an indie 1980s-themed isometric Action RPG from Friends of Safety, combining hack-and-slash combat, open-world exploration, and story-rich dark fantasy. Players navigate a demon-infested Miami, Arizona, uncovering secrets, completing quests, and shaping their hero through five distinct classes—Barbarian, Knight, Rogue, Necromancer, and Sorcerer. With both singleplayer and local co-op, the game rewards exploration, tactical combat, and character progression in a pixel-graphic, alternate history world.

Exploration and Open-World DesignInterconnected Map, Secret Locations, and Dynamic Encounters

The game’s open-world design encourages players to explore freely, interact with quirky NPCs, and tackle Demon Generals in any order. Hidden areas, side quests, and environmental storytelling reward curiosity, making each journey through Miami, Arizona feel unique. Exploration is core to progression, seamlessly combining combat, narrative, and discovery in a story-rich RPG experience.

Story, Dark Fantasy, and 1980s AestheticCosmic Horror, Coming-of-Age Drama, and Alternate History

The narrative blends cosmic horror, supernatural stakes, and coming-of-age storytelling in a small Arizona town. From the satanic ritual that unleashes Baphomet to tense encounters with possessed townsfolk, Kingdom of Night immerses players in a dark fantasy, 1980s-inspired world. Exploration and combat both advance the story, creating a memorable, layered RPG experience.
